US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"receiving authorization"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it in contexts where someone is obtaining permission or approval for an action or process. Example: "Before proceeding with the project, we must ensure that we are receiving authorization from the relevant authorities."

Ludwig's WRAP-UP

The phrase "receiving authorization" is a grammatically sound and usable phrase in English, as confirmed by Ludwig AI, denoting the act of obtaining official permission or approval. It's most commonly found in news and media, as well as scientific contexts. While uncommon in overall frequency, it carries a neutral to professional tone, suitable for formal communication. Related phrases include "obtaining permission" and "getting approval". A key best practice is to specify the source of authorization for increased clarity, and it is important to ensure necessary prerequisites are met before anticipating the authorization.

FAQs

How do I use "receiving authorization" in a sentence?

You can use "receiving authorization" to describe the act of obtaining permission or approval for a specific action. For example: "After "getting approval", the project could finally commence."

What is a good alternative to "receiving authorization"?

Alternatives to "receiving authorization" include "obtaining permission", "getting approval", or "securing clearance" depending on the context.

What's the difference between "receiving authorization" and "giving authorization"?

"Receiving authorization" means that you are the one getting permission, while "giving authorization" means you are the one granting it. They are opposite actions.

Is "receiving authorization" formal or informal?

"Receiving authorization" is generally considered a neutral to formal expression. It's suitable for professional, academic, and official contexts.
